
Last Wednesday, about 30 state House Republican lawmakers pushed the passing of legislation that would guarantee Pennsylvanians the right to choose health care plans, regardless of federal mandates.
“Do you want Obamacare?” said Rep. Matthew Baker, R-Tioga County, the bill’s sponsor. “Do you want to pay higher taxes? Do you want less quality in heath care?”
